Also known as Avobenzone, this ingredient is a chemical sunscreen filter that provides protection in the UV-A range.
Avobenzone is globally approved and is the most commonly used UV-A filter in the world.
Studies have found that avobenzone becomes ineffective when exposed to UV light (it is not photostable; meaning that it breaks down in sunlight). Because of this, formulations that include avobenzone will usually contain stabilizers such as octocrylene.
However, some modern formulations (looking at you, EU!) are able to stabilize avobenzone by coating the molecules.
Avobenzone does not protect against the UV-B range, so it's important to check that the sunscreen you're using contains other UV filters that do!
The highest concentration of avobenzone permitted is 3% in the US, and 5% in the EU.

It is a chelating agent, meaning it neutralizes metal ions that may be found in a product.
Disodium EDTA is a salt of edetic acid and is found to be safe in cosmetic ingredients.

Homosalate is not photo-stable, meaning it's strength as a UV filter degrades over time with exposure to the sun. Because of this, it's often used in combination with other chemical sunscreen filters as avobenzone (which protects from the UV-A range). Homosalate also helps act as a solvent for harder-to-dissolve UV filters.
(Part of the reason that sunscreens need to be frequently re-applied is due to the photo instability of many chemical sunscreen filters)
Currently, homosalate is approved in concentrations up to 10% in the EU and 15% in the US. The FDA is currently doing further research on the effects of homosalate, and it is possible that these approved concentrations will change in the future.

It is a common sunscreen ingredient and often paired with avobenzone, a UVA filter. This is because octocrylene stabilizes other sunscreen ingredients by protecting them from degradation when exposed to sunlight. Octocrylene is a photostable ingredient and loses about 10% of SPF in 95 minutes.
Octocrylene also acts as an emollient, meaning it helps skin retain moisture and softens skin. It is oil-soluble and hydrophobic, enhancing water-resistant properties in a product.
Those who are using ketoprofen, a topical anti-inflammatory drug, may experience an allergic reaction when using octocrylene. It is best to speak with a healthcare professional about using sunscreens with octocrylene.

There are two forms of panthenol: D and L.
D-panthenol is also known as dexpanthenol. Most cosmetics use dexpanthenol or a mixture of D and L-panthenol.
Panthenol is famous due to its ability to go deeper into the skin's layers. Using this ingredient has numerous pros (and no cons):
Like hyaluronic acid, panthenol is a humectant. Humectants are able to bind and hold large amounts of water to keep skin hydrated.
This ingredient works well for wound healing. It works by increasing tissue in the wound and helps close open wounds.
Once oxidized, panthenol converts to pantothenic acid. Panthothenic acid is found in all living cells.
This ingredient is also referred to as pro-vitamin B5.

It's often used in formulations along with Caprylyl Glycol to preserve the shelf life of products.
Water. It's the most common cosmetic ingredient of all. You'll usually see it at the top of ingredient lists, meaning that it makes up the largest part of the product.
So why is it so popular? Water most often acts as a solvent - this means that it helps dissolve other ingredients into the formulation.
